The Samsung Galaxy S10 Plus, released in March 2019, and the iPhone XS Max, launched in September 2018, represent flagship smartphones from their respective manufacturers. While both devices offer large, vibrant displays and capable camera systems, they differ in their operating systems and design philosophies. The Galaxy S10 Plus runs on Android, offering more customization, while the iPhone XS Max operates on iOS, known for its integrated ecosystem. These differences cater to distinct user preferences regarding software experience and hardware features.

Durability

When considering the longevity of these devices, several factors come into play, including their release timelines, software support, and physical durability.

  • Release Timeline and Software Support: The iPhone XS Max, released in September 2018, typically receives iOS updates for approximately five to six years from its launch. The Galaxy S10 Plus, launched in March 2019, generally receives major Android OS updates for three years and security updates for four years. This means the iPhone XS Max may have reached the end of its major OS update cycle, while the Galaxy S10 Plus has also concluded its major OS updates and is nearing the end of its security update period.
  • Repairability: The Galaxy S10 Plus received a repairability score of 3 out of 10 from iFixit, indicating it is difficult to repair due to components like the glued-in battery and extensive use of adhesive for the glass panels. While a specific iFixit score for the iPhone XS Max was not readily available, iPhones generally present moderate repair challenges. Common issues reported for the iPhone XS Max include charging problems and display anomalies, which may require professional attention.
  • Expected Practical Lifespan: Both devices, being older flagship models, are likely to offer a practical lifespan of several more years for general use, though performance for demanding applications may gradually decline. Users seeking the longest possible software support might find newer models more suitable, but for everyday tasks, both can continue to function effectively.

Performance

The performance of a smartphone is largely determined by its internal processing capabilities, memory, and how efficiently it manages power for daily tasks.

  • Processing Power: The iPhone XS Max is equipped with Apple's A12 Bionic chip, while the Galaxy S10 Plus features either the Exynos 9820 or Snapdragon 855 processor, depending on the region. Both chipsets were high-end for their time, enabling smooth operation for most applications and multitasking. The A12 Bionic chip was noted for its strong performance, particularly in graphics and machine learning tasks.
  • Multitasking and Storage: The iPhone XS Max typically comes with 4GB of RAM, whereas the Galaxy S10 Plus offers 8GB or 12GB of RAM. This difference in RAM can impact the number of applications that can run simultaneously in the background without needing to reload. For storage, the iPhone XS Max is available with 64GB, 256GB, or 512GB, without expandable storage. The Galaxy S10 Plus offers 128GB, 512GB, or 1TB internal storage, with the option to expand via a microSD card up to an additional 512GB.
  • Battery Behavior: The Galaxy S10 Plus houses a larger 4100 mAh battery, which consistently delivered excellent endurance in tests, often lasting over 12 hours of continuous web surfing. The iPhone XS Max has a 3174 mAh or 3179 mAh battery, providing a full day of moderate to high usage and around 10 hours and 38 minutes in similar web surfing tests. The Galaxy S10 Plus also supports reverse wireless charging, allowing it to charge other compatible devices.

Screen quality

The display is a primary interface for smartphone interaction, and both devices offer high-quality viewing experiences with distinct characteristics.

  • Display Technology and Resolution: Both the Galaxy S10 Plus and the iPhone XS Max feature OLED display technology, which provides deep blacks and vibrant colors. The Galaxy S10 Plus boasts a 6.4-inch Dynamic AMOLED display with a resolution of 1440 x 3040 pixels, resulting in approximately 522 pixels per inch (ppi). The iPhone XS Max features a 6.5-inch Super Retina HD OLED display with a resolution of 2688 x 1242 pixels, yielding about 458 ppi.
  • Brightness and Clarity: The Galaxy S10 Plus's Dynamic AMOLED panel is capable of reaching up to 1200 nits of peak brightness, enhancing visibility in bright conditions and supporting HDR10+ content. The iPhone XS Max offers a typical maximum brightness of 625 nits, with some reports indicating up to 725 nits on the home screen and 660 nits for full-screen content, also supporting HDR. Both displays offer excellent clarity for viewing text and images.
  • Design and Features: The Galaxy S10 Plus features an 'Infinity-O' display with a punch-hole cutout for its front cameras, maximizing screen real estate. The iPhone XS Max utilizes a notch design at the top of its display to house the front camera and Face ID sensors. Both screens incorporate features like wide color support and high contrast ratios, contributing to an immersive visual experience.

Audiovisual

Both smartphones were considered top-tier camera phones at their release, offering versatile systems for capturing photos and videos.

  • Rear Camera System: The Galaxy S10 Plus features a triple-camera setup on the rear: a 12MP wide-angle lens with a variable aperture (f/1.5-2.4), a 12MP telephoto lens with 2x optical zoom, and a 16MP ultra-wide-angle lens. This provides flexibility for various shooting scenarios, from expansive landscapes to zoomed-in subjects. The iPhone XS Max has a dual-camera system, consisting of two 12MP lenses: a wide-angle (f/1.8) and a telephoto (f/2.4) with 2x optical zoom. Both devices include optical image stabilization (OIS) on their main and telephoto lenses.
  • Photography Performance: The Galaxy S10 Plus is praised for its vibrant colors and excellent dynamic range in good lighting conditions, with its ultra-wide lens offering unique perspectives. However, some users noted that low-light performance could be inconsistent, and the ultra-wide lens might exhibit distortion at the edges. The iPhone XS Max delivers consistent image quality with good detail and color accuracy, particularly in well-lit environments.
  • Video Recording and Front Camera: Both phones are capable of recording 4K video at 60 frames per second. The Galaxy S10 Plus features a dual front camera (10MP wide and 8MP depth sensor) capable of 4K video recording, offering enhanced selfie portraits with adjustable background blur. The iPhone XS Max has a single 7MP front-facing camera, also capable of good quality selfies and video calls.
  • Audio Experience: Both devices are equipped with stereo speakers, providing a more immersive audio experience for media consumption. The Galaxy S10 Plus also retains a 3.5mm headphone jack, a feature absent on the iPhone XS Max.

Miscellaneous

Beyond core performance, several practical elements contribute to the overall user experience and daily usability of these smartphones.

  • Connectivity and Ports: Both the Galaxy S10 Plus and iPhone XS Max support modern connectivity standards, including 4G LTE, Wi-Fi (802.11 a/b/g/n/ac/ax for S10 Plus, 802.11ac for XS Max), and Bluetooth. The Galaxy S10 Plus features a USB-C port for charging and data transfer, along with a 3.5mm headphone jack. The iPhone XS Max uses Apple's proprietary Lightning port and does not include a headphone jack.
  • Biometric Security: The Galaxy S10 Plus introduced an ultrasonic in-display fingerprint sensor for biometric authentication. The iPhone XS Max relies solely on Face ID, Apple's facial recognition system, for secure unlocking and payments.
  • Build Materials and Durability: Both phones feature premium builds with glass fronts and backs, protected by Corning Gorilla Glass 6 on the S10 Plus. Both also carry an IP68 rating for dust and water resistance, meaning they can withstand submersion in up to 1.5 meters of water for 30 minutes for the S10 Plus, and 2 meters for 30 minutes for the iPhone XS Max.
  • Dimensions and Handling: The Galaxy S10 Plus measures 157.6 x 74.1 x 7.8 mm and weighs 175g (glass model) or 198g (ceramic model). The iPhone XS Max measures 157.5 x 77.4 x 7.7 mm and weighs 208g. The slightly narrower width of the S10 Plus might make it marginally easier to handle for some users, despite both being large-screen devices.

User sentiment for both the Galaxy S10 Plus and iPhone XS Max generally highlights their strengths as premium devices from their respective eras. For the Galaxy S10 Plus, common praise points include its expansive and vibrant Dynamic AMOLED display, versatile triple-camera system, and impressive battery life, often exceeding a full day of heavy use. Users also appreciated features like the headphone jack and expandable storage. Criticisms sometimes focused on inconsistent low-light camera performance and potential distortion from the ultra-wide lens.

The iPhone XS Max received acclaim for its stunning OLED display, powerful processing capabilities, and consistent camera performance. Face ID was also a frequently lauded feature for its convenience and security. However, some users reported issues with charging, weak network signals, and an aggressive skin-smoothing effect in the selfie camera. The absence of a 3.5mm headphone jack was also a point of contention for some.

Users prioritizing a highly customizable Android experience with a versatile camera, exceptional battery life, and expandable storage may find the Galaxy S10 Plus well-suited to their needs. Its inclusion of a headphone jack and reverse wireless charging offers additional practical benefits. Conversely, individuals who prefer the streamlined iOS ecosystem, robust performance for demanding applications, and a consistent dual-camera system might lean towards the iPhone XS Max. Its strong display and Face ID security are key differentiators.
